Matthew - Jesus is the Subject
Ben Allen • East Coast Anglican • Sermon • • 11 views • 26:20
Jesus teaches against the abuse of oaths and vows in people's attempts to not have to do what they say. Yet, says Jesus, his followers should simply do what they say and not do what they say they won't. There should be no attempts made to get around what you've said. The faithfulness demanded of Christians points us to the perfect faithfulness of Christ to deal with the guilt and sin of our unfaithful ways.

Acts Series
John DeVries • The Christian Reformed Church of St. Joseph • Sermon • • 10 views • 41:13
The Nazirite vow was taken voluntarily to dedicate oneself to the Lord in a special way. It was a defined period of separating oneself from things and separating oneself to the Lord. Is God calling you to a defined period of special devotion to him?
